21 RAWSON CLOSE is a very small semi-detached house of 60m², built in 2021, which could now be worth an estimated £196,903. It was last sold for £192,000 in November 2025, which was around 19% below the average November 2025 semi-detached price in the Sheffield local authority area. The most recent EPC inspection was November 2021, where the current energy rating was B, and the potential energy rating was A.

What might 21 RAWSON CLOSE be worth now?

21 RAWSON CLOSE might now be worth an estimated £196,903.

This is based on house price inflation of 2.6%, between November 2025 and April 2026, for semi-detached houses, in the Sheffield local authority area, as calculated by the Office for National Statistics and published in their UK House Price Index (HPI).

The 2.6% inflationary increase is applied to the most recent sale price for 21 RAWSON CLOSE of £192,000 on 7th November 2025. For the value to have increased from £192,000 to £196,903 over the one year and seven months to April 2026, the following assumptions must hold true:

  • The value of 21 RAWSON CLOSE has moved in line with the HPI for semi-detached houses in the Sheffield local authority area.
  • The November 2025 sale price of £192,000 represented a fair market value for the property.
  • The size, condition, and specification of 21 RAWSON CLOSE has not materially changed since November 2025.
